3) Tea, originating from China, is one of the most consumed beverages globally. It is made from the leaves of the Camellia sinensis plant and comes in various types, including green, black, oolong, and white tea. Each type undergoes different processing methods, resulting in distinct flavors and aromas. Tea culture has a rich history and is celebrated in rituals, ceremonies, and social gatherings in different cultures worldwide.
